Elche vs Real Madrid prediction: this La Liga clash pits a struggling relegation candidate against one of Europe's in-form sides. Elche sit 19th with just one point from four games, conceding at an alarming rate of three goals per match, while Real Madrid occupy third place with a points-per-game rate of 2.25 and the league's meanest defense outside Barcelona.
Elche have lost their last two La Liga outings, shipping nine goals in three matches and failing to keep a clean sheet all season. Real Madrid, by contrast, have won three of their last four, scoring ten and conceding just three, though their sole defeat came in their most recent outing against Real Betis.
Real Madrid do carry a lengthy injury list into this trip, missing several first-team players through muscle and knee issues, but their squad depth should still comfortably outclass a leaky Elche backline.
Given the 16-place table gap, the two-point-per-game differential, and bookmakers pricing Real Madrid at odds of 1.29, this looks a routine away win. Expect goals at both ends given Elche's defensive fragility, but Real Madrid's superior firepower should be decisive. A comfortable away victory is the clear expert pick here.

The two sides have met twice in the past two years, both league fixtures. Real Madrid won 4-1 away at Elche in March 2026, while the reverse fixture in November 2025 ended 2-2 at Elche's ground. That draw shows Elche can be competitive at home in isolated moments, but the recent 4-1 hammering underlines Real Madrid's overall dominance in this fixture, particularly on the road.

Elche have won none of their last three La Liga matches, losing twice and drawing once, and currently sit rock bottom of the table with just one point. Their defense has been the major issue, shipping nine goals in three games including a 5-0 thrashing by Barcelona. They've also failed to score in one of those outings. Y. Santiago is sidelined with a knee injury, further weakening an already stretched squad. With relegation form and a goals-conceded rate of three per game, Elche will need a defensive masterclass simply to stay competitive against a rampant Real Madrid side visiting Elche this week.

Real Madrid have won three of their last four league matches, scoring ten goals and conceding only three, a rate of 2.5 scored and 0.75 conceded per game. Their only blemish was a narrow 1-0 loss to Real Betis in their most recent outing. Despite a heavy injury list — including Rodrygo, Tchouameni, Camavinga and Militao all missing recent fixtures — squad depth has kept results strong. Sitting third with 2.25 points per game, Real Madrid's attacking output remains elite, and even with rotation likely given a congested fixture schedule, their quality should easily overwhelm an Elche defense conceding at a high rate.

Elche vs Real Madrid - Match Analysis
Real Madrid sit third in La Liga with 2.25 points per game, compared to Elche's bottom-placed 0.25 points per game — a 16-place gap in the standings. Real Madrid have scored ten goals in four matches while Elche have conceded nine in three, including a 5-0 defeat to Barcelona. Bookmakers reflect this gulf in class with Real Madrid priced at odds of 1.29, implying a 73% win probability.
